The Importance of Bone Density
Having strong bones is essential for overall health and longevity. Good bone density not only helps prevent fractures and injuries but also plays a crucial role in maintaining proper posture and mobility as we age.

Understanding Osteoporosis
Osteoporosis is a bone disease characterized by low bone density and increased risk of fractures. It is often caused by a deficiency of essential nutrients such as calcium, vitamin D, and other minerals necessary for bone health.
can you improve bone density naturally?
Yes, it is possible to improve bone density naturally through a combination of dietary changes, regular exercise, and lifestyle modifications. By incorporating bone-strengthening foods and engaging in weight-bearing exercises, you can promote bone health and reduce the risk of osteoporosis.

- Calcium: This mineral is essential for building and maintaining strong bones and teeth.
- Vitamin D: Helps the body absorb calcium and plays a crucial role in maintaining bone health.
- Magnesium: Supports bone density and helps regulate calcium levels in the body.
- Vitamin K: Important for bone formation and helps improve bone density.
- Phosphorus: Works with calcium to build strong bones and teeth.
- Zinc: Supports bone growth and helps with bone repair processes.
- Boron: A trace mineral that aids in the metabolism of calcium and magnesium for bone health.

1. What is the best way to increase bone density?
To increase bone density, focus on a balanced diet rich in calcium, vitamin D, and other essential nutrients. Additionally, engage in weight-bearing exercises such as walking, jogging, or weightlifting.
